Puppy Play and Stay: The Perfect Solution for Busy Pet Parents

Puppy play and stay, also known as doggy daycare, offers a safe and structured environment for your furry friend to socialize, exercise, and learn while you’re away. These facilities typically provide a variety of activities tailored to the needs of puppies, including supervised playtime with other dogs, potty training, and basic obedience training.

1. Importance of Puppy Play and Stay

Enrolling your puppy in a play and stay program can provide numerous benefits for both you and your pet, including:

  • Socialization: Puppies learn valuable social skills by interacting with other dogs of all ages and sizes, helping them to develop confidence and prevent behavioral problems later in life.
  • Exercise: Puppies have boundless energy, and play and stay programs provide a safe and supervised environment for them to run, jump, and play, ensuring they get the exercise they need to stay healthy and happy.
  • Training: Many play and stay programs incorporate basic obedience training into their daily routine, helping puppies to learn essential commands such as sit, stay, and come.
  • Potty training: Puppies can also benefit from the potty training assistance offered at play and stay programs, which can help to speed up the process and reduce accidents in your home.

2. FAQs about Puppy Play and Stay

Here are some frequently asked questions about puppy play and stay programs:

Q: What age can puppies start attending play and stay?

Most play and stay programs accept puppies as young as 8-10 weeks old, after they have received their initial vaccinations.

Q: How long can puppies stay at play and stay?

The length of time puppies can stay at play and stay varies depending on the program, but most offer full-day, half-day, and extended-day options.

Q: What should I look for in a play and stay program?

When choosing a play and stay program, look for one that is reputable, experienced, and has a clean and safe facility. It’s also important to ensure that the staff is trained and experienced in handling puppies.

Q: How much does puppy play and stay cost?

The cost of puppy play and stay varies depending on the program and location, but typically ranges from $25 to $50 per day.
